+Webserver checklist
+~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
+
+After setting up the web server, please verify that the following things work
+both for your mirror address (www#.mplayerhq.hu) and the DNS round-robin
+address (www.mplayerhq.hu):
+
+- The virtual host is reachable by its address.
+- The subdirectories MPlayer, DOCS and homepage work.
+- The man pages and documentation are served with the correct content-type.
+ Try Russian or Chinese, you will notice breakage immediately.
Setting up an FTP server
~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
-Any FTP server will do. We use vsftpd, it's fast and secure. You should have
-the same directory layout as we do on our server, so there should be a
-subdirectory named 'MPlayer' (notice the capitals) that contains the
-downloadable files.
+Any FTP server will do. We use vsftpd, it is fast and secure. The setup is
+similar to the web server setup. The FTP server should listen on both its mirror
+address (ftp#.mplayerhq.hu) and the DNS round-robin address (ftp.mplayerhq.hu).
+All our mirrors are public, so you should allow anonymous access.
+You should have the same directory layout as we do on our server, so there
+should be a subdirectory named 'MPlayer' (notice the capitals) that contains
+the downloadable files.
